Korean BBQ Chicken Sandwich

Savor the Joy of Korean BBQ Chicken Sandwich Bliss

This Korean BBQ Chicken Sandwich provides bold flavors and savory delight in a handheld feast, perfect for quick weeknight dinners.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Chilling Time 15 minutes
Total Time 50 minutes
Servings: 4 sandwiches
Course: Lunch
Cuisine: Korean
Calories: 450

Ingredients
  

For the Chicken Marinade
  • 1 pound Chicken Thighs Boneless chicken breasts can be used as a substitute.
  • 1/4 cup Soy Sauce Low-sodium soy sauce is a healthier option.
  • 1/4 cup Brown Sugar White sugar can work in a pinch.
  • 2 tablespoons Honey Maple syrup is a great vegan alternative.
  • 2 tablespoons Gochujang Korean chili flakes can substitute for a milder taste.
  • 1 tablespoon Rice Vinegar Apple cider vinegar is a suitable replacement.
  • 1 tablespoon Sesame Oil Opt for a neutral oil if preferred.
  • 2 cloves Garlic Garlic powder can be used if fresh isn’t available.
  • 1 tablespoon Fresh Ginger Ground ginger can be a good substitute.
For the Cabbage Slaw
  • 2 cups Shredded Green & Red Cabbage Bok choy can be a fresh alternative.
  • 1 medium Carrot Red bell peppers are a nice substitution.
  • 1/2 cup Mayonnaise Vegan mayo or yogurt can replace it.
  • 1 tablespoon Sugar Optional based on your taste preference.
  • 2 tablespoons Green Onions Chives can be used instead if desired.
  • 1 tablespoon Toasted Sesame Seeds Optional.
For the Sandwich Assembly
  • 4 pieces Bread Buns Brioche or potato buns are recommended.
  • 2 tablespoons Butter Use olive oil as a dairy-free choice.

Equipment

  • Skillet or Grill Pan
  • Bowls

Method
 

Marinate the Chicken
  1. In a large bowl, whisk together soy sauce, brown sugar, honey, gochujang, rice vinegar, sesame oil, minced garlic, grated ginger, and sesame seeds until well combined. Add chicken thighs, ensuring they are thoroughly coated in the marinade. Cover and let marinate for at least 20 minutes, or up to 2 hours.
Prepare the Cabbage Slaw
  1. In a separate bowl, combine shredded cabbage with julienned carrot. Whisk together mayonnaise, rice vinegar, sugar, salt, and pepper for the dressing. Pour over cabbage mixture, tossing well. Chill in the refrigerator for at least 15 minutes.
Cook the Chicken
  1. Heat a skillet or grill pan over medium-high heat. Add marinated chicken thighs, cooking for 6-7 minutes until charred. Flip and cook for another 4-5 minutes until cooked through. Let rest for 5 minutes before slicing.
Toast the Buns
  1. Spread butter on the cut sides of the buns and toast butter-side down in a skillet over medium heat for 2-3 minutes until golden brown.
Assemble the Sandwich
  1. Place a sliced chicken thigh on the bottom bun, drizzle with BBQ sauce, top with cabbage slaw, and cap with the top bun.
